Maple Ridge is a census-designated place in southwestern Mahoning County, Ohio, United States, located between Alliance and Sebring. The population was 667 at the 2020 census . It is part of the Youngstown–Warren metropolitan area .

Seneca County is a county located in the northwestern part of the U.S. state of Ohio.As of the 2020 census, the population was 55,069. [1] Its county seat is Tiffin. [2] The county was created in 1820 and organized in 1824. [3]

New Springfield is an unincorporated community and census-designated place in southern Springfield Township, Mahoning County, Ohio, United States. The population was 579 at the 2020 census. [3] It is part of the Youngstown–Warren metropolitan area. It lies at the intersection of State Routes 165 and 617.
